This patch forces clk initialisation of rk3399 cpu in u-boot proper.
Normally it should only be initialised in SPL as it is "time consuming".
Doing so however leaves cpus clocked to low frequencies
for Rockchip's DDR/loader/trust with mainline u-boot scenario
which does not involve SPL phase.
Signed-off-by: Piotr Szczepanik <piter75@gmail.com>
